Hi, I have an '04 Toyota Prado Diesel turbo, when the engine cools it wont start or won't start in the morning...seems to be a feul prob, any sugestions? tnx
Sounds like a glow plug problem,if it starts o.k. when warm,but not when cold,does it smoke a lot when trying to start it cold,if so i would say your glow plugs are either burned out or theres no power to them when you turn on the key,do you see the glow plug light on the dash,it may light,but that doesn,t mean the glow plugs are getting power
changed the glow plugs made shure they get electricity and they do but still a few seconds 10 to make it run and a lot of black smoke when starting the engine in the morning.
depending on the outside ambient air temp,does the glow plug light go out telling you its ready to start?if you try starting before this you foul the glow plugs and load up the cylinders with cold fuel(unburned)then when it fires it will burn a white to black at first to burn this off depending on the outside air temp again
